The State Foundation for Health Innovation Contest Offers 594 Vacancies for All Education Levels, with Salaries up to R$ 8,1 Thousand.
The State Foundation for Health Innovation, known as Inova Capixaba, announces the opening of a public contest, which will cover 594 vacancies in various positions within the Health area. The available positions in the announcement encompass elementary, middle, technical, and higher education levels, and salaries range from R$ 1,529.86 to R$ 8,013.60.
The selected professionals will be allocated to two strategic hospitals: the Central State Hospital, located in Vitória, and the Antônio Bezerra de Faria Hospital, in Vila Velha.
Exams Will Be Held on June 30
The selection process for the contest of the State Foundation for Health Innovation will include objective and title exams, with assessments scheduled to be held on June 30.

The opportunities are varied, distributed among positions such as warehouse assistant, nursing technician, administrative assistant, and cook, among others at the Antônio Bezerra de Farias Hospital, as well as various specializations at the higher level such as analysts, social workers, nurses, pharmacists, and doctors in different specialties.
594 Vacancies in the Health Area for the Levels: Elementary, Middle, Technical, and Higher
Elementary Level: Warehouse Assistant and Pharmacy Assistant
Middle Level: Administrative Assistant and Cook
Technical Level: Nursing Technician in the hospital area, in the surgical area, in the material sterilization area, in the intensive therapy area; Nutrition Technician; Occupational Safety Technician; Immobilization Technician; Radiology Technician and Blood Bank Technician.
Higher Level: Analyst in the Administrative area, in the Accounting-Financial area, in the People Development area, in the Payroll area, in the Quality area, in the Bidding and Contracts area, in the Supplies area, in the Teaching, Research, and Innovation area, Clinical Analyst; Social Worker; Nurse in the Hospital area; in the Intensive Therapy area; quality; education and research, patient safety core, NIR – Internal Regulation Core, labor; Occupational Safety Engineer; Pharmacist; Physiotherapist; Speech Therapist; Regulation Doctor, Labor Doctor, Auditor Doctor, Nutritionist; Psychologist and Occupational Therapist.
Exemption from the Registration Fee
Additionally, some candidates for the contest of the State Foundation for Health Innovation will have the possibility to request exemption from the registration fee, including those registered in CadÚnico, bone marrow and blood donors, people with disabilities, those exempt from declaring Income Tax, and citizens summoned and appointed by the Electoral Justice. The period to request the exemption will be from May 6 to 8.
Registration for the Contest of the State Foundation for Health Innovation
Those interested can register from May 6 to June 2, through the website of the Institute for Development and Training (Idcap). The registration fee varies according to the level of the position: R$ 52 for elementary level, R$ 70 for middle/technical level, and R$ 75 for higher level. The announcement can be accessed here.
